Gabby Concepcion opens up about renewed friendship with Sharon Cuneta

Estimated reading time: 3 minutes and 11 seconds
16px

In a recent interview, Gabby Concepcion expressed his happiness that his former wife, Sharon Cuneta, continues to wear the friendship ring he gave her during the Hawaii leg of their Dear Heart eight-city concert tour in the U.S. and Canada late last year.

He shared, “Yes, it’s nice to know that she still wears it. I believe that giving a ring is powerful, especially if it’s a smartwatch and a ring brand. It will help you sleep well.”

The actor revealed that he gave the Megastar a different brand of ring because he only had one health ring at the time of their tour. “That’s right! I even went to the mall to buy her one, and I’m glad she liked it,” he added.

This positive development suggests their relationship is in a better place now compared to previous years. “Yes, our concert allowed us to renew our friendship. It was a good thing for us. From that point on, I’ve been happy to see her reels, which people send me, where she’s always wearing the ring. I want to sincerely thank her for cherishing that friendship!”

Interestingly, he also received a gift from Sharon. “She gave me color-blind glasses, which I constantly use. I wore them for a pictorial in one of my latest endorsements. Well, it’s public knowledge that I’m colorblind. She wanted me to wear the glasses so I could see her more clearly.”

Gabby appreciates the thoughtful gift. “Of course! It’s only now, at least from my perspective, that I can see a version of green. I’m the only one who knows what that color looks like to me. I’ve taken several color-blind tests, and green and red are the colors I can’t see. Most of the time, I only see blue or black and white. But I think it’s good because I’m not a racist—I’m just colorblind. I cherish her gift because it’s my first pair of color-blind glasses. No one has ever given me something like this before.”

Fans are eager for another concert tour featuring the two.

“As for that, I can’t give a definite answer yet. We haven’t discussed any possible offers for shows abroad. But I’m hoping it will eventually happen!”

However, the veteran actor said he might not have time for a concert tour at the moment due to his commitments with GMA.

“I’m under contract with Kapuso. Cameras will start rolling for my next soap very soon. From what I know, it will run until November, so I might not be able to do the concert tour if ever,” Gabby said.

In his recent social media posts, Mavy Legaspi shared his excitement about being selected as one of the new co-hosts for the much-anticipated Pinoy Big Brother (PBB) Celebrity Collab Edition, a collaboration between GMA and ABS-CBN.

The young star wrote, “Thank you, Lord! I can’t wait to meet the housemates and learn from the amazing PBB hosts. I won’t let any of you down. Ready to host!”

The Kapuso heartthrob is aware that some are not impressed with his hosting skills and had this to say: “Thank you for all the love and support, guys. It’s honestly so overwhelming. I’ll do my very best. I’ll take any constructive criticism moving forward and use it to become a better host.

All the extra noise is just unnecessary. I suggest you keep it to yourself because it doesn’t work on me. All love.”

Mavy is thrilled about this new chapter in his showbiz career.

“Honestly, I’m very excited to meet the new batch of housemates from Sparkle and Star Magic. Just being part of the show is a great feeling. I’ve been watching PBB since I was a kid, so to be one of its new hosts is definitely flattering,” he said.
